⚙️ Advanced Technical Specifications
Designed for outdoor wet environments and optimized wherever you want to install it
Aeration Power
Nano-bubble + Micro-bubble
Bubble concentration >150M/ml
Flow rate 21 L/min
Power Consumption
4 Amps (~900 W)
Single-phase 220V
Noise <65 dB
Multi-Function
Simultaneous injection of oxygen, air, and ozone
Automatic night disinfection mode
Oxygen retention for several hours
Safety Features
Pressure sensor + audible alarm
Alarm relay output
Auxiliary oxygen/ozone input
📊 Comparison with Traditional Methods
See the difference between this device and splash, jet, and diffuser – make the best decision.
| Feature | Splash | Jet | Diffuser | ✨ Air/Water System |
|---|---|---|---|---|
| Max Effective Depth | ✗ 0.5 m | ✗ 2 m | ✗ 1 m | ✓ 6 m |
| Bubble Size | Coarse (>5mm) | Medium (1-3mm) | Variable coarse | Nano + Micro |
| Bubble Concentration | Very low | Medium | Low | >150M/ml |
| Power Consumption (W) | 3,000 | 2,500 | 1,500–2,500 | 900 |
| Monthly Cost (IRR)* | ≈ 8.5 million | ≈ 7 million | 4.5–7 million | ≈ 2.5 million |
| Oxygen Transfer Efficiency | 1.2 | 1.5 | 1.0 | 2.5 |
| Energy Reduction | — | — | — | 50–70% |
*Monthly cost based on 24-hour daily operation and average agricultural electricity tariff.

❓ Frequently Asked Questions
Everything you need to know about the Air/Water system (nano‑micro bubble generator)
Unlike splash and jet aerators that produce coarse, short-lived bubbles, this device creates over 150 million nano and micro bubbles per milliliter that penetrate to 6m depth and remain in the water for hours. Its oxygen transfer efficiency is 2.5 (20 times that of a splash aerator).
Only 900 watts (about 4 amps) on single‑phase 220V. That means you can run the device from an ordinary wall outlet.
The fine bubbles spread uniformly to a depth of 6 meters, leaving no oxygen dead zones in the pond.
Regular air, pure oxygen (90‑95%), and ozone. The device can simultaneously provide oxygenation and disinfection.
Yes, by connecting an ozone generator (O₃) to the auxiliary input, the device produces ozone nanobubbles that are 3000 times more powerful than chlorine and destroy 99.9% of bacteria and viruses in 5 minutes.
The output water should appear milky and turbid. Additionally, the digital display shows voltage and current. If pressure drops, an audible alarm activates.
Nanobubbles remain in the water for several hours, so a 1‑2 hour outage will not cause fish loss. The device also has an alarm relay output that can start an emergency generator.
With 24‑hour daily operation and agricultural electricity rates, around 2.5 million Tomans. This is up to 70% lower than splash and jet systems.
With one device, under ideal conditions, up to 10 tons of trout, 6 tons of carp/tilapia, and up to 12 tons of sturgeon. We recommend starting at 70% of this capacity.
